So yeah, I'm trying to clean up my hard drive and came across this small game I hadn't played before. It's like an H game with the H and only one route. Really, it's just a story. Anyway a review is in order.

Story spoilers below...

So the story is from the persepctive of an un-named 20 year old who has some circulatory problems. He meets a quiet 22 year old loli in the same infirmary he's in (which is reserved for those going to die). One day they go out on a trip since neither wants to die in the hospital or at home.

Anyway, it tries to be a tear jerker, but I didn't like the main character's way of dealing with things, and the girl also comes across as a bit if a stuck up b*tch until around the end.
